im home!
i got other things to tend to this week that ive missed since ive been out of town but here is a quick recap?
jacksonville florida
crowd: small but hype
promoter: paid without having to be tracked down
our performance: we werent ready to go from not performing for a while to 40 minutes but we pulled it off enough
accommodations: hotel 6 in the building! nobody was shot while selling drugs during our stay. win.
asheville north carolina
crowd: who? wha?
promoter: cool guy but it take money to make money, money.
our performance: we performed for the openers and the 7 people walking around and they loved it
accommodations: i dont wanna talk about it
charlotte north carolina
crowd: large de la soul following
promoter: paid once we found her in the club across the street
our performance: a speaker fell on my ankle and we kept going thats a a plus off the top haha
accommodations: college friends of don and ilyas and the coolest couple in NC. i still say the worst part of touring is having to impose on people/find someone to crash with on certain stops (we need that tourbus popping)
chapel hill north carolina
crowd: small but hype
promoter: i dont even remember, with all due respect at this point i was just ready to leave nc. that monday was the longest day ever
our performance: this one was a lot of fun to me. they didnt have a cdj and we had to use a discman :-( but we made it work.
accommodations: another college friend of don and ils.
savanna ga
crowd: danny (d swain!) and off duty strippers were in the crowd. great crowd already!
promoter: awesome! she didnt show up until after the show which had me worried, but she came through like "whats up sorry heres your money...and heres some more money for a hotel...and hey maybe if you find some girls heres some more money for liquor or whatever...you guys have a good night"
our performance: doing all of that energetic shit at the end officially started to wear on me at this point. not complaining, but from this point on i just began to dread the final 2 songs. i dont know how people do 2 hour shows and whatnot
accommodations: to the laquintaaa we went (c) big boi
cincinnati ohio
crowd: nice crowd! it was looking shaky for a minute but a lot of people came at the last minute
promoter: paid in full and let us draink a few
our performance: good minus the super loud accapella monitors i literally thought i was gonna damage my eardrums and shit lol...joints were LOUD AS ALL HELL. this was a really fun performance.
accommodations: it was home for il and don! we were straight
lexington kentucky
crowd: mad cunninlinguists fans (it was their album release party)
promoter: kno knows how it goes so of course an artist made fellow artists feel comfortable and shit...paid!
our performance: i think the people dancing and screaming and nodding and waving and etc....was a good sign.
accommodations: back to cincinnati
cleveland ohio
crowd: pretty good crowd
promoter: great dude. everything was fine.
our performance: it was iight. i can point out things that brought the performance down but i wont make excuses. it was only iight.
accommodations: the smoking jacket (after-partying on the road is super super super super super super super super overrated)
pittsburgh pa
crowd: decent but not enough
promoter: another cool cat. where were these cool promoters on the new royalty tour? van damme. aside from everyone being cool, everyone actually PAID! WOW!
our performance: i was wack because i was officially sick by then, but don was really everywhere so he made the show. i got worried for a second when he straight up stopped when his mic cut off early on, but he came back and him and il held it down.
accommodations: they stayed at the holiday inn and i slept on the bus back to brooklyn.
now what?
in my perfect world id find a job i didnt mind going to and id go to it for a few months while working on the tanya morgan ep that comes out around march 2008. id also take that job money and renovate my "studio" situations. i dont know whats next for me personally but i do know im about to lie down an get some rest.
